Overview

Taj West End, Bengaluru, founded in 1887 by the Bronsons, is one of the city’s most iconic heritage hotels. Acquired by the Taj Group in 1984 on a 99-year lease, the property was carefully restored to preserve its character. Spread across acres of gardens, the hotel radiates colonial architecture. Over the years, it has hosted world leaders like Angela Merkel and Theresa May, and major Hollywood icons, and is one of the oldest continuously running hotels in India. Dining is a distinctive experience with globally inspired and regional cuisines. Guests can indulge in the J Wellness Circle spa, offering ancient Indian rituals. The hotel was awarded the National Tourism Award 2017 for Best Luxury Hotel in the 5-Star Deluxe Category.

History

Founded in 1887 by the Bronsons as a modest 10-room inn, Taj West End, Bengaluru has grown into one of the city’s most iconic landmarks. In 1905, the Spencers acquired the property for Rs. 4,000 (USD 45), expanded it with 20 additional rooms, and named it “The West End.” When the Taj Group leased it for 99 years in 1984, the contract ensured the historic name would be preserved. Nestled within acres of historic gardens, the property is home to centuries-old cycads.

The Taj West End is one of the oldest continuously running hotels in India, with timeless elegance woven into every corner, from its lush lawns and renowned event spaces to housing the oldest functioning postbox in the city, crowned in honour of Queen Victoria’s coronation.

Design and Architecture

At Taj West End, Bengaluru, the Heritage Wing, built in 1905, is one of the finest examples of colonial architecture in the city. With its tiled roofs, white pillars, and long verandahs, it instantly takes you back a hundred years. The building has been carefully restored, keeping its old character while adding modern luxuries that make it feel warm and welcoming. Outside, there’s even a restored horse carriage made in Wimbledon, London, a reminder of how people once travelled around Bangalore. The lounge is almost like a little museum, with hand-drawn maps of colonial India, Persian zodiac charts, and the original rosewood bar stand from the Bronsons’ inn. Step outside and you’ll spot cycads, trees that date back to the dinosaur age.

Walk down the Heritage Corridor and you’ll see old sepia photos from the past. If you look closely, you might even spot Winston Churchill in one. The lawns outside are home to Bengaluru’s second-oldest rain tree, planted in 1848, its wide branches forming a beautiful green canopy. The colonial buildings take up only a small part of the property, leaving plenty of space for tropical gardens and lotus ponds. Each block of rooms is named after an Indian flower, Frangipani, Gardenia, and more. Beyond the gardens, the hotel offers a swimming pool tucked into the greenery. The property is also wheelchair-accessible, with toilets fitted with grab rails, so every guest can enjoy with ease.

Dining

Blue Ginger

Blue Ginger was one of India’s first Vietnamese restaurants, and it still feels special. Set in an open-air pavilion with soft lights and rustling leaves, it’s calm and welcoming. The food is simple but full of flavour, fresh herbs, light broths, and delicate textures.

Opening hours: Lunch - 12:30 pm to 2:45 pm; Dinner - 07:00 pm to 11:45 pm
Cuisine: Vietnamese
Dress code: Smart Casual

Loya

Loya brings together flavours from across North India, smoky from Kashmir, rich from Punjab, and full of depth from the hills. The chefs here use old techniques like dhungar for a smoky touch, baghar to temper spices, and dum to slow-cook everything just right.

Opening hours: 12:00 pm to 11:45 pm
Cuisine: Indian
Dress code: Smart Casual

Machan

Machan, around since 1978, is the hotel’s all-day spot and a bit of a legend in the city. Inspired by the jungle, it has earthy tones, an open kitchen, and a casual buzz that fits any mood. Whether it’s breakfast before meetings or a late dinner after a long day, Machan always feels easy to walk into.

Opening hours: 7:00 am to 11:30 pm
Cuisine: Multi-Cuisine
Dress code: Smart Casual

Celebrity Guests

Prince Charles - British prince (now King Charles III), stayed at the hotel during his time in Bangalore.

Sir Ronald Ross - British physician, wrote down the cure for malaria in the hotel gardens, winning the Nobel Prize for Medicine in 1902.

David Lean - British film director, used the property as the colonial set for the film A Passage to India.

Angela Merkel - German Chancellor, stayed during official visits.

Theresa May - British Prime Minister, visited while in office.

Julia Roberts - Hollywood actress, stayed at the hotel during her visit to India.

Just beyond the property, Bangalore Palace, built in 1887 by Maharaja Chamarajendra Wadiyar, is a magnificent blend of Tudor and Scottish Gothic architecture. Lalbagh Botanical Garden, spread over 240 acres, features 2,150 plant species, a glasshouse that hosts biannual flower shows, an aquarium, a lotus pool, and 3,000-year-old rock formations.

Art lovers will enjoy the National Gallery of Modern Art, housed in the restored Manikyavelu mansion, which displays around 500 works of modern Indian art and hosts gallery walks, film screenings, dance performances, talks, and children’s workshops. History buffs can explore Tipu Sultan’s Summer Palace, a stunning example of Indo-Islamic architecture. Nearby K.R. Market offers a bustling scene of copperware, spices, and local goods to complete the experience.
